Статистика
Всего в нашей базе более 4 327 664 вопросов и 6 445 979 ответов!

Решите в программе С , ребят. Не в С++, а именно в С.

10-11 класс

22JumpStreet 10 мая 2013 г., 13:59:34 (11 лет назад)
Рейтинг
+ 0 -
0 Жалоба
+ 0 -
Gfgdchb
10 мая 2013 г., 15:59:49 (11 лет назад)

#include <stdio.h>
#include <locale.h>
void main()
{setlocale(LC_ALL,"rus");
int a[1000]; int n,i,summ=0,proizv=1;
printf("Введите число элементов массива: "); scanf("%d",&n); printf("Введите элементы массива: ");
for(i=0;i<n;i++){a[i]=0;scanf("%d",&a[i]);}
for(i=0;i<n;i++){if(a[i]<0)proizv*=a[i];if(a[i]>0)summ+=a[i]; }
printf("Сумма положительных элементов массива: ");printf("%d",summ);printf("\n");
printf("Произведение отрицательных элементов массива: ");printf("%d",proizv);printf("\n"); system("pause");
}
Вродже так. Но надо бы проверять наличие отрицательных.

Ответить

Читайте также

Помогите решить, очень нужно... 2. Составьте блок-схему алгоритма(её не надо) и программу вычисления в массиве A(10) количества положительных

элементов.
3. Составьте программу заполнения массива, не используя клавиатуру, числами: 1, 3, 5, 7, 9, 11, 13, 15, 17, 19.

помогите решить Напишите программу, которая в последовательности натуральных чисел определяет сумму чисел, кратных 6. Программа получает на вход

количество чисел в последовательности, а затем сами числа. В последовательности всегда имеется число, кратное 6. Количество чисел не превышает 100. Введённые числа не превышают 300. Программа должна вывести одно число – сумму чисел, кратных 6. Пример работы программы: Входные данные Выходные данные 3 12 25 6 18 20.2

. Какие программы из перечисленных не относятся к прикладному программному обеспечению?

а) текстовые процессоры б) обучающие программы
с) антивирусные программы д) системы управления базами данных

1. Составьте программу ввода и вывода массива: 5, -2, 3, -6, 7, 9, -4, 8, 1, 2, 7, -3.

2. Составьте блок-схему алгоритма и программу вычисления в массиве A(10) количества положительных элементов.
3*. Составьте программу заполнения массива, не используя клавиатуру, числами: 1, 3, 5, 7, 9, 11, 13, 15, 17, 19.



Вы находитесь на странице вопроса "Решите в программе С , ребят. Не в С++, а именно в С.", категории "информатика". Данный вопрос относится к разделу "10-11" классов. Здесь вы сможете получить ответ, а также обсудить вопрос с посетителями сайта. Автоматический умный поиск поможет найти похожие вопросы в категории "информатика". Если ваш вопрос отличается или ответы не подходят, вы можете задать новый вопрос, воспользовавшись кнопкой в верхней части сайта.